The area feels dry to the touch. Why is professional drying still required?

Surface dryness is deceptive. Structural drying follows the IICRC S500 psychrometric standard, requiring the removal of absorbed moisture from building materials to a specific equilibrium. For Hazel Green's climate, this means reducing the moisture in the air to 38 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. A 'dry' surface can still have high vapor pressure, driving moisture into walls and subfloors in Downtown Hazel Green, leading to concealed damage and microbial growth.

My home was built in 1973. Are there special regulations for the water damage work?

Yes. The EPA's Renovation, Repair, and Painting (RRP) Rule mandates lead-safe practices for any disturbance of painted surfaces in homes built before 1978. Since your 1973 home predates the cutoff, our protocol requires EPA-certified testing and containment before any demolition or drying that could create dust. What is 'Grey Water,' and how does it affect my insurance cla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ination from sources like washing machines or dishwasher leaks. It requires specific antimicrobial treatment per S500 standards, unlike clean Category 1 water. Proactive measures like installed I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o) can mitigate this risk. How soon must water be removed to prevent mold?

The documented mold growth window is 48-72 hours after initial intrusion. Initiating IICRC-compliant extraction, drying, and decontamination within this period is the recognized Standard of Care.
